Mark Muyobo consolidates NCBA’s post-merger growth in Uganda; ends profits drought

NCBA Bank Uganda posted an 18.4% growth in net profit for the 12 months ended December 2023⏤ a UGX4.3 billion growth from the UGX22.8 billion it posted in 2022, to UGX27 billion in 2023. 

This is the second successive net profit by the bank since Mark Muyobo assumed its leadership, ending two years of successive post-merger losses.
